Artist Steve Gerberich’s work might best be described as ”Rube Goldberg meets junk collector.” His whimsical pieces win him fans the world over and in fact, many visitors have fond memories of Gerberich’s last exhibition at the Stamford Museum and Nature Center- Springs, Sprockets and Pulleys – in 2001.
